An SR-22 insurance agent in Fort Washington, Pennsylvania helps drivers file the required certificate of financial responsibility with PennDOT. This form is typically needed after a DUI, serious traffic violation, or license suspension. Pennsylvania law mandates that an SR-22 be maintained for three years without a lapse in coverage to keep driving privileges active.

What Does a SR-22 Insurance Agent in Fort Washington Cost?

The cost of an SR-22 insurance policy in Pennsylvania typically ranges from $300 to $1,200 per year, depending on your driving record, age, and the insurance company. The SR-22 filing fee itself is usually around $15 to $25. Actual premiums can be higher for drivers with multiple violations or a DUI conviction. Frequently Asked Questions

What does an SR-22 insurance agent in Fort Washington do?
An SR-22 insurance agent helps you obtain the required certificate from your insurer and files it with the Pennsylvania Department of Transportation. They also assist in finding a policy that meets state minimum liability limits of 15/30/5.
How long must I carry an SR-22 in Pennsylvania?
Pennsylvania law requires you to maintain an SR-22 filing for three consecutive years. If your policy lapses or is canceled, the insurer must notify PennDOT, which can lead to another suspension of your license.
Can I get an SR-22 policy if I do not own a car in Fort Washington?
Yes, you can obtain a non-owner SR-22 insurance policy in Pennsylvania. This policy covers you when driving a vehicle you do not own and satisfies the state filing requirement without needing a personal auto policy.
